About Scarborough 6019

The size of Scarborough is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 14.9% of total area. The population of Scarborough in 2016 was 15467 people. By 2021 the population was 17605 showing a population growth of 13.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Scarborough is 30-39 years. Households in Scarborough are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Scarborough work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.40% of the homes in Scarborough were owner-occupied compared with 56.40% in 2016.

Scarborough has 11,167 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Scarborough have seen a 82.04%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 78.52% increase. As at 31 October 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Scarborough is $1,326,345 while the median value for Units is $810,213.
  • Houses have a median rent of $975 while Units have a median rent of $740.
There are currently 53 properties listed for sale, and 19 properties listed for rent in Scarborough on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 546 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Scarborough.
